MERV stands for Minimum Efficiency Reporting Value. It is an industry standard that rates the efficiency of air filters. Higher MERV ratings capture more and smaller particles, but they may slightly reduce airflow.
Check the size printed on the outer frame of your current filter or measure the length, width, and depth directly. Use the nominal size (e.g., 14 x 20 x 1) for ordering replacements.
Look for an arrow on the side of the filter indicating airflow direction. Install the filter with the arrow pointing towards the HVAC unit or fan.

Replace filters every 1-3 months for standard use or more frequently if you have pets, allergies, or high usage. Learn more here
Higher MERV filters provide better filtration but may reduce airflow in systems not designed for them. Consult your HVAC manufacturer.
Synthetic media filters are durable and resist moisture, while fiberglass filters are cost-effective but may degrade faster in humid environments.
Replace filters regularly, use the correct MERV rating, and ensure your system is maintained for optimal airflow and energy efficiency.
